emacs package setup hook: Fix
1. Make the test more robust 2. EMACSLOADPATH may be initially undefined. 3. did `targetOffset` twice when meant `hostOffset` too
This commit is contained in:
parent
f1481f2c90
commit
ca782498a9
|
@ -1,11 +1,11 @@
|
|||
addEmacsVars () {
|
||||
if test -d $1/share/emacs/site-lisp; then
|
||||
export EMACSLOADPATH="$1/share/emacs/site-lisp:$EMACSLOADPATH"
|
||||
if [[ -d "$1/share/emacs/site-lisp" ]]; then
|
||||
export EMACSLOADPATH="$1/share/emacs/site-lisp${EMACSLOADPATH:+:}${EMACSLOADPATH-}"
|
||||
fi
|
||||
}
|
||||
|
||||
# If this is for a wrapper derivation, emacs and the dependencies are all
|
||||
# run-time dependencies. If this is for precompiling packages into bytecode,
|
||||
# emacs is a compile-time dependency of the package.
|
||||
addEnvHooks "$targetOffset" addEmacsVars
|
||||
addEnvHooks "$hostOffset" addEmacsVars
|
||||
addEnvHooks "$targetOffset" addEmacsVars
|
||||
|
|
Loading…
Reference in New Issue